EP317 It’s never just about the behavior (with Claire English from The Unteachables)

What if the key to managing challenging student behavior isn’t about "fixing" the kids—but about regulating yourself? In this episode, we explore a sustainable approach to classroom management that shifts the focus to what you can control. Join me and my guest, Claire, as we discuss how self-regulation empowers teachers to create calmer, more effective learning environments while building trust and healthier responses in students.
Here’s what we cover in this episode:
- Why traditional behavior management strategies often fall short.
- How self-regulation in teachers sets the tone for the entire classroom.
- The role of neuroscience in understanding student behavior and stress responses.
- Practical strategies for co-regulation and creating micro-moments of connection.
- Why “fixing” student behavior isn’t your job—and what you can do instead.
- How to craft an “island of safety” in your classroom, even without strong school-wide support.
- Tools and systems to help students develop self-regulation skills.
- Tips for avoiding burnout and emotional exhaustion when working with extreme behaviors.
Discover how small, intentional shifts in your mindset and practice can make a big impact. Whether you’re a new teacher feeling overwhelmed or a seasoned educator looking for fresh ideas, this episode is full of practical insights to help you guide behavior sustainably—without carrying the weight of fixing everything.
